Freshwater mussels (Bivalvia: Unionoida) are interesting because of their unique life cycles, global aggregate distribution and ancient origin. They are also of practical importance due to their worldwide, imperiled status. Of utmost utility for their continued study are a modern assessment of global and regional species diversity and a natural classification that reflects phylogenetic patterns.…
